On a totally unrelated note I just read that Sierra Games is making a Ghostbusters video game. It looks like a first person shooter type game, and Bill Murray, Dan Ackroyd, Harold Ramis, and Ernie Hudson are all doing the voices of their characters. One surprisingly absent co-star is Rick Moranis. I had been wondering, not too long ago, whatever happened to Bob McKenzie/Louis Tulley. Well, when the Sierra people approached Moranis about lending his voice to the game he flat out refused. Why? He made a mint on the Honey, I Shrunk The Kids movies and has completely retired from show biz. On the one hand this is kinda surprising since he always seemed to bring such a sense of fun to his roles, but on the other hand I have to wonder why more stars don't do this. I mean, if you have ten or twelve million in the bank, do you really need to work anymore?
